HTML5中,p是通用的块级容器,article用于包裹独立的内容片段,section用于表示文档中的有主题的部分。HTML5 引入了多种语义化标签,以帮助开发者构建更具结构性和可访问性的网页。p、article 和section 是其中三个常用的结构元素,它们在语义和使用场景上有所不同,以下是对这三个标签的详细区别及使用介绍:
p
| 特性 | 描述 |
| 用途 | 用于文档中的分区或节。 |
| 语义 | 无具体语义,仅用于样式化或脚本化。 |
| 使用场合 | 作为布局、样式化或脚本钩子时使用。 |
| 示例 | |
section
| 特性 | 描述 |
| 用途 | 表示文档中的专题性分区或节。 |
| 语义 | 比p 强,通常包含标题(如h1 至h6)。 |
| 使用场合 | 文章的章节、标签对话框中的标签页、论文中有编号的部分等。 |
| 示例 | |
article
| 特性 | 描述 |
| 用途 | 表示文档中独立的内容块,可以独立于其余内容存在。 |
| 语义 | 强调内容的独立性和完整性,通常包含标题和可能的页脚。 |
| 使用场合 | 论坛帖子、新闻文章、用户评论等。 |
| 示例 | |
通过上述对比,可以看出p、section 和article 在 HTML5 中各有其特定的用途和语义。p 是最通用的容器,没有特定语义;section 用于有主题性的内容分区,通常包含标题;而article 则用于表示独立的、完整的内容块,这些内容块可以在其他上下文中独立存在,了解这些标签的正确使用,可以帮助开发者构建更加语义化和结构化的网页。
本文地址:https://www.lifejia.cn/news/85120.html
免责声明:本站内容仅用于学习参考,信息和图片素材来源于互联网,如内容侵权与违规,请联系我们进行删除,我们将在三个工作日内处理。联系邮箱:cloudinto#qq.com(把#换成@)
